图片
你是否正在经历这样的开发者困境?
👉 想用GitHub记录开发日志,却担心隐私信息泄露
👉 需要保存API密钥,却害怕成为AI大模型的训练"养料"
👉 希望白嫖公有代码平台的存储服务,又不愿暴露核心代码
👉 依赖git的line diff跟踪改动,但加密文件会破坏对比功能
正是洞察到这种当代开发者的"既要又要", Easy Cipher Content 应运而生。这款 VS Code 插件创造性地实现了:
🔐 加密数据当明文用 - 让你既能享受公有代码平台的便利,又能守护数据主权
🗝️ AI看不懂的隐私防护 - 加密后的内容无法被大模型解析学习
📌 真正的零成本安全 - 免费云存储+企业级加密的完美组合
🔍 加密不改diff体验 - 独家行级加密技术保留git对比功能
今天向各位开发者推荐一款安全 VS Code 插件工具—— Easy Cipher Content 。这款由国内团队开发的开源工具,让数据安全保护变得像保存文件一样简单。
核心功能亮点
1. 一键式安全防护
- 文本文件支持逐行加密(保留文件结构)
- 二进制文件全文件加密(生成.enc扩展名文件)
- 支持同时处理整个工作区或指定目录
图片
2. 企业级加密标准
- 采用AES-GCM和ChaCha20-Poly1305两种军用级算法
- 加密过程完全在本地完成,数据不出本机
3. 智能工作流整合
- 编辑器标题栏直接操作(无需打开命令面板)
- 智能路径建议与文件浏览器整合
- 支持.gitignore风格的忽略规则(.easy-cipher-content-ignore)
3分钟快速上手
步骤1:安装插件在VS Code扩展商店搜索"Easy Cipher Content",点击安装即可
步骤2:配置密钥(两种方式任选)
# 推荐方式:环境变量(更安全)
export VSCODE_EXT_ECC_AESGCM_PASSWORD="你的强密码"
export VSCODE_EXT_ECC_CHACHA20_SALT="自定义盐值"
# 或使用JSON配置文件
{
"aes-gcm": {
"password": "your-password",
"salt": "your-salt"
}
}
步骤3:开始使用
- 单个文件:在编辑器顶部点击🔒/🔓按钮
- 批量操作:通过命令面板执行"Encrypt All Files in Workspace"
- 路径选择:支持快速建议/手动输入/文件浏览器三种方式
常见问题解答
Q:加密后的文件还能用diff工具比较吗?
A:文本文件逐行加密后,diff结果仍能显示改动行数,但内容为密文
Q:如何判断文件是否已加密?
A:文本文件会有规律的行结构,二进制文件默认添加.enc扩展名
Q:忘记密码怎么办?
A:由于采用强加密算法,没有后门机制,请务必妥善保管密钥
现在访问VS Code扩展商店,搜索"Easy Cipher Content",立即为你的代码加上安全锁!
图片